Choosing the Right Robot Vacuum

A robot vacuum will help you keep your home tidy. It is essential to choose the right robot vacuum for your requirements. Some features to look for include mopping, self-emptying bins and recognition of objects.

There are models that can be used as mops to remove spills and pet hair. Some of these models come with a dock that automatically refills the tank and swaps the mop pads.

Features

A robot vacuum is a small robotic device that utilizes advanced sensors to detect objects and complete a thorough cleaning job. It is equipped with a motor to generate suction power, which draws in dust, dirt and other debris embedded in carpet fibers. It has side brushes and a main brush to move debris and agitate it into the dustbin. Some models also come with a mopping pad that can be used to scrub floors.

Robot vacuums use infrared or laser sensors to navigate. These sensors create a map of the space and help avoid collisions. They can detect objects and create digital zones that are completely closed. Some high-end robotic devices feature laser navigation using dToF (distance to objects) which lets them move more efficiently than traditional robots. You should be aware that these robots can collect personal data and share it with other people.
